搜索
查看: 14242|回复: 20

[折腾] [教程] 变废为宝,旧电脑打造家用文件服务器

[复制链接]
发表于 2021-11-21 19:25:54 | 显示全部楼层 |阅读模式
一、前言
随着信息时代的发展,数据变得越来越重要。家里的照片,工作的文档,手里几个T的资源,该归于何处?
U盘性能不足性价比低
移动硬盘备份吧,要在各个设备间插拔还得担心不慎掉落毁盘的风险
百度云,提价限速恶心你,上传的资源就不是你的资源了,随时给你屏蔽

这时候就需要一种可靠的本地的文件存储解决方案,那就是NAS

NAS全称Network Attached Storage:网络附属存储。按字面简单说就是连接在网络上,具备资料存储功能的装置,因此也称为“ 网络存储器 ”。它是一种专用数据 存储服务器 。它以数据为中心,将存储设备与服务器彻底分离,集中管理数据,从而释放带宽、提高性能、降低总拥有成本、保护投资。其成本远远低于使用专业服务器存储,而效率却远远高于后者。大部分国内中小企业大都使用群晖或者威联通的NAS作为文件存储方案。
这两家的NAS设备起步1000左右,中高端要3、4k。对于一般家用来说,确实没必要花能买一台台式机的价格入手NAS。但是搭建一台文件服务器的门槛真有这么高吗?未必。下面来介绍如何用旧笔记本打造家用文件服务器。

不要1998,不要998,只要25买一块U盘加上一台废旧笔记本。
NAS基本架构,CPU+主板+内存+硬盘+网口+UPS+NAS系统。UPS对于NAS很重要,可以防止因为意外断电损坏机械盘。一般最便宜能用的UPS在400大洋左右,而笔记本自带电池,不用担心突然断电或者电压不稳,直接省去了UPS。

系统方面,选用开源的OMV。市面上的常见NAS系统有黑群晖、FreeNAS、Unraid、OMV等。黑群晖相当于盗版系统,无法享受群晖官方的服务就失去一半的价值了,系统升级还大概率直接挂掉。FreeNAS基于freebsd,硬件支持少,需要8GB内存,想想笔记本要真有8GB内存可以直接运行Window当主力机用了。Unraid需商业授权,试用版限速30MB/s,还不如用U盘呢。OMV基于Linux老大哥Debian,开源免费,历经多次版本更替,目前最新版是刚出炉的OMV6测试版,本人追求稳定选用OMV5。

简述一下OMV硬件需求
  • CPU: 任何 x86-64 或 ARM 兼容的处理器
  • 内存: 1 GiB容量
  • 硬盘:
    • 系统驱动器:最小 4 GiB 容量(但大于 RAM 容量),#一般是2倍内存容量即可
    • 数据驱动器:容量根据您的需求

对比我10年前买的旧笔记本T420i
CPU:二代i3,TDP35W
内存:4G(其中2G后来加的,不加跑不动Win7,T_T)硬盘:500G机械
U盘口还被我暴力插坏一个,剩两个
网口不知道规格,但能跑满机械盘速度
系统驱动器是上PDD买了个闪迪酷豆16G,USB2.0接口,花费24.3RMB。因为长期插在笔记本上,买小一点好看。

10年前的笔记本现在看来,除了功耗低,一无是处。但对于OMV来说简直太奢侈了,甚至可以考虑把2G内存咸鱼30一个出了hhh

废话不多说,这就开干

二、系统的安装
官网下载OMV镜像

看清楚,点Stable,得到一个600多MB镜像,用rufus写入一个空闲的U盘(这个大家应该都有吧),然后这个盘和闪迪酷豆一起插笔记本上,开机从写入镜像的U盘启动。

由于我不想再重新装一边,所以安装过程就参见Openmediavault Omv5的安装示意_哔哩哔哩_bilibili吧。装过Debian的看着一定很眼熟。
注意:
1、在选择语言的时候最好选English,不然用到控制台时可能无法显示中文字符
2、地区选中国,之后换源时就可以选国内源,速度杠杠的。
3、选择安装位置时选中我那个16G的闪迪U盘,不用分区,直接全盘安装,省心省力。
最后提示装完后重启,设置BIOS优先从闪迪U盘启动,拔掉之前的镜像U盘即可

三、配置使用
参见Openmediavault Omv5 常规设置_哔哩哔哩_bilibili
仅使用网络存储功能,大致需要
1、建一个NAS用户,设置密码
2、指定一个硬盘上的共享文件夹,配置NAS用户的读写权限
3、开启SMB服务,配置NAS用户的读写权限
4、点击保存,应用
与群晖不同的是,OMV使用硬盘不一定需要格式化,机械盘上原有的内容都可以保留。当然为了性能,我选择分一个ext4分区给NAS(Linux挂载NTFS得靠ntfs-3g,不如ext4原生支持好),剩下的留给旧的Win7系统,这样还可以重启后选择启动Win7.

视频中有windows客户端使用NAS共享的示例,大家映射一下网络驱动器即可当一般的外接硬盘使用。如果家里网线网口没有性能瓶颈,上下行都能保证100MB/s的机械盘速度(为什么要加这一句,因为我在搞NAS的过程中发现家里路由器性能居然不如光猫,导致了30MB/s的内网速度)。
安卓端推荐使用MiXplorer,可以配置SMB协议的存储器。安卓TV大多自己能搜到SMB,输一下用户密码即可。

四、omv-extra插件
群晖有各种插件扩展功能,OMV也有自己的omv-extra插件
各种插件介绍说明见https://www.openmediavault.cn/fo ... 6%e4%bb%8b%e7%bb%8d
插件的安装见openmediavault omv5 安装omv-extra插件_哔哩哔哩_bilibili
由于我是在U盘上装OMV,所以flashmemory插件必装,此插件作用是减少对系统U盘的读写,延长系统U盘的寿命
miniDLNA整理维护硬盘上的视频、音乐、图片,用支持DLNA(UPNP)的软件即可分类读取。TV上用KODI,安卓用VLC即可搜索到DLNA,缺点是只显示文件名,没有缩略图。

五、Docker
如果还没有你想要的功能,可以安装Dock容器,参考openmediavault 使用docker安装wordpress_哔哩哔哩_bilibili
这个我还没有尝试,就不多说了

六、基于Debian
OMV最大的优势是基于Debian,如果以上功能还不能满足你,你可以装上Xorg和诸如xfce、kde之类的桌面环境,完全把他当成Linux桌面系统使用,不用时则不启动桌面。临时要用windows还可以装虚拟机。

七、总结
笔记本装OMV的优点如下:
1、变废为宝,十年前的笔记本咸鱼500都没人要,性能却可以吊打各种NAS成品
2、笔记本做NAS,省去UPS,额外的花费只要一个25块U盘
3、系统装U盘上,这样硬盘不用时可以休眠。省电同时降低故障率,我买了一个可测功率的小米插座,使用17W左右,听说最简单的猫盘都得10W。
4、基于Debian的OMV,免费开源,用着放心。又有不俗的扩展性,新手配置SMB当网盘用,高手可以折腾出各种花样。
缺点也有:
1、没有服务器专用的ECC内存,长期使用无法保证100%没有内存错误。
2、旧笔记本硬盘一般只有500G,有不够用的可能,但就算换一块笔记本硬盘最高也就1T。外接硬盘吧,旧笔记本一般只有USB2.0口,传输速率又成了瓶颈。
3、想不出缺点了,以后再补充吧

总的来说,旧笔记本打造家用文件服务器适合家里有性能落后的旧笔记本,可用于体验NAS,轻度使用。需大容量NAS可以考虑买硬件自组。如果需要企业级的稳定性,建议选择成品方案。

*B站视频随便找的,非本人,侵权删


本文转自《变废为宝,旧笔记本打造家用文件服务器》
http://wuyou.net/forum.php?mod=viewthread&tid=427881&fromuid=749611(出处: 无忧启动论坛)

回复

使用道具 举报

发表于 2021-11-21 22:19:50 | 显示全部楼层
???
这是类似私人云的意思?
回复

使用道具 举报

发表于 2021-11-22 08:02:01 来自手机 | 显示全部楼层
变废为宝了,不错啊
回复

使用道具 举报

发表于 2021-11-22 09:10:54 | 显示全部楼层
非常实用,准备弄个低能耗的电脑玩玩。
回复

使用道具 举报

发表于 2021-11-22 10:23:52 | 显示全部楼层
这帖子不错,刚好最近在看办公服务器                        
回复

使用道具 举报

发表于 2021-11-22 16:54:29 | 显示全部楼层
好贴,非常实用,谢谢分享,,
回复

使用道具 举报

发表于 2021-11-22 18:08:33 | 显示全部楼层
进来学习下!感谢楼主分享教程
回复

使用道具 举报

发表于 2021-11-22 22:32:24 | 显示全部楼层
龍在天涯 发表于 2021-11-22 08:02
变废为宝了,不错啊

老电脑,家里扔了好几个,都不知道能干啥~~
回复

使用道具 举报

联系我们(Contact)|手机版|萝卜头IT论坛 ( 苏ICP备15050961号-1 )

GMT+8, 2024-11-22 09:26 , Processed in 0.105266 second(s), 23 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表